About

LU1948826372.EUFUND refers to an investment fund domiciled in Luxembourg. Without further information, it's impossible to specify its exact investment strategy, sector focus, or risk profile. However, generally, Luxembourg-domiciled funds are regulated under EU law and are often marketed internationally to a broad range of investors. Potential investors should consult the fund's official prospectus and Key Investor Information Document (KIID) to understand its specific objectives, risks, fees, and performance before investing.

Factors

Investment Strategy: The fund's allocation decisions, sector focus, and geographic exposure influence returns.

Market Conditions: Overall market trends, economic indicators, and investor sentiment impact asset valuations.

Fund Performance: Historical performance, relative to benchmarks, attracts or deters investors.

Management Fees: Expense ratios directly affect net returns for investors.

Currency Fluctuations: Currency movements impact the value of international investments within the fund.

Interest Rates: Interest rate changes influence bond yields and overall market valuations.

Regulatory Changes: Regulatory shifts affecting investment management or specific sectors impact valuations.

Supply and Demand: Investor demand and fund flows drive unit prices.

Underlying Asset Performance: The performance of the specific assets held by the fund is critical.

Geopolitical Events: Global political instability and crises create market volatility.
